Overview
We are seeking an Alternative Delivery Engineer in Atlanta, GA to help work on various alternative delivery projects.
Your role
The candidate will have proven experience or a deep interest in working on Alternative Delivery projects.
Proven experience in highway project delivery is required; experience in other service sectors is also of interest.
Proven ability to successfully act as a design lead or lead technical professional on large, multi-discipline assignments is required.
Work closely with the project manager and other discipline leads to effectively deliver key components of the projects by closely defined schedule dates.
Able to quickly adapt to changing conditions or changes in design policies and understanding the impact on project delivery needs and schedules.
Ensure compliance with relevant codes, standards, and regulations, including AASHTO, FHWA, and GDOT requirements
Lead/train junior team members with developing technical skills in compliance with GDOT policies
Analyze and prepare roadway and Temporary Traffic Control Plans (TTCP) designs, staging/MOT plans, calculations and drawings for Expressway/Limited-Access facilities and Arterial/Local roads using GDOT and/or local jurisdiction criteria, with guidance provided on complex matters
Apply a strong working knowledge of GDOT Design Policy Manual, Driveway and Encroachment Manual, Drainage Manual and other guidance documents , GDOT Standards and Details and GDOT Plan Development Process

About you
B.S. or M.S. in Civil or construction engineering.
10-14 years of experience.
Georgia P.E. license or ability to obtain within three months of employment is required.
Specific experience in delivery of design-build and/or P3 projects is desired, but not required.
Significant CAD and design software (OpenRoads) proficiency is required.
